Bad Memories v0.9 is a story-rich, adult visual novel developed by BM_Rec that explores the intersection of psychological trauma and personal growth. The "recreation" aspect specifically refers to the updated versions of the game where players confront their character's past to build a better future. The Narrative Core: Facing the Past
In Bad Memories, players step into the role of a protagonist returning to their hometown years after fleeing a turbulent childhood. The story revolves around:
Childhood Trauma: Dealing with the aftermath of a mother's death and a father's descent into alcoholism.
Self-Refinement: Using these "bad memories" as a catalyst for change rather than a permanent anchor.
Player Choice: Decisions directly influence character relationships and the eventual progression of the story. What’s New in Version 0.9? bad memories v09 recreation
The v0.9 update, released in August 2024, brought significant "recreations" and additions to the game’s existing framework. Key updates include:
Expanded Scenes: New content for every female character and deeper story progression.
Visual Enhancements: A substantial number of new renders and animations to improve the visual storytelling.
Route Flexibility: More options for players who wish to explore or avoid specific character routes, such as Rachel or Katherine. Bad Memories v0
Technical Fixes: Tons of bug fixes and early scene adjustments to streamline the experience for newer hardware. Development and Availability
The project is an ongoing indie venture, often supported by a community on Patreon. Platforms: Available on Windows, macOS, and Linux.
Distribution: Can be found on platforms like Itch.io and Steam.
